We are seeking a skilled and adaptable BI Analyst with a hybrid background in Salesforce Health Cloud and Informatica to join our analytics and infrastructure team. This role requires a hands-on professional comfortable bridging business intelligence, ETL workflows, and infrastructure-level troubleshooting across cloud platforms.
Project overview:
This role supports the OAPI/Pharma business line by managing data integrations between Salesforce Health Cloud and Informatica, ensuring seamless data flow between systems. You’ll troubleshoot virtual machine access via SSH, facilitate migration of outputs into Airflow, and support AWS infrastructure while interfacing with Google Cloud-hosted systems. The position plays a key role in enabling actionable insights and operational stability across complex, cross-platform data ecosystems.
